Raspberry Anywhere features and specs

  • Remote Accessibility
    Raspberry Anywhere allows users to access their Raspberry Pi devices remotely, which is highly advantageous for managing and monitoring these devices without needing physical proximity.
  • Ease of Use
    The platform is designed to be user-friendly, making it accessible for users who are not particularly tech-savvy.
  • Secure Connection
    It offers a secure connection protocol, ensuring that data transmission between the device and the user is encrypted and protected from potential security threats.
  • Multi-Device Support
    Supports multiple devices, allowing users to manage more than one Raspberry Pi device from a single interface.

Possible disadvantages of Raspberry Anywhere

  • Potential Latency Issues
    Depending on the user's internet connection speed and the location of the Raspberry Pi, there might be latency issues affecting the performance of remote access.
  • Cost
    There may be associated costs with using Raspberry Anywhere, especially if advanced features or premium services are required.
  • Dependency on Internet
    The service heavily relies on an active internet connection, which means any interruption in connectivity can disrupt service.
  • Limited Offline Functionality
    While providing extensive remote capabilities, Raspberry Anywhere offers limited functionality when not connected to the internet.
